💡 Tips

  • Walk or bike along the Ráckeve-Soroksár Danube (RSD) branch, which features beautiful natural scenery just outside Budapest.
  • Mosquitoes can be very active near the water in summer, so bring a reliable repellent.
  • You can easily reach Budapest from here via the suburban railway (HÉV) or local trains, making it a peaceful base.
  • If you plan to fish, ensure you buy a daily local ticket at the nearby fishing stores or online.

Dunavarsány is situated in the southern outskirts of the Budapest metropolitan area, close to the Ráckeve branch of the Danube, and serves as a premier destination for water-based recreation and professional sports training in Central Hungary. Over the past few decades, the town has transitioned from a rural community into a thriving suburban center, characterized by its excellent connectivity and high quality of life. The area is particularly famous for its network of artificial lakes, remnants of former gravel pits, which have evolved into scenic resorts with exceptionally clear water, attracting anglers and holidaymakers from across the region. A key landmark is the Dunavarsány Olympic Training Center, a world-class facility where elite athletes prepare for international competitions, including the Olympic Games. Economically, the town benefits from a balance between its growing industrial park and traditional agricultural land, making it a sustainable and attractive place for residents. The local community places great value on preserving its diverse cultural heritage, including its Swabian roots, which are reflected in local architecture and festivals. Surrounded by the unique flora and fauna of the Danube-Tisza Interfluve, Dunavarsány features a first-rate blend of modern infrastructure and natural beauty.

Sights in the town Dunavarsány (4)

Statue Park of Famous Statesmen🏙 civic

Located in the settlement center, these busts created by Zoltán Szabó represent prominent figures in Hungarian history. The collection includes likenesses of Lajos Batthyány and Ferenc Deák.

1956 Revolution Memorial🏺 historical

Designed by Sándor Györfi, this monument commemorates the heroes of the Hungarian Uprising of 1956. The sculpture is a key site for the city's annual national remembrance ceremonies.

Statue of Pope John XXIII🏺 historical

Erected in 1992, this bronze statue honors the legacy of the beloved Pope in Dunavarsány. The artwork is a symbol of faith and the religious heritage of the local community.

World War Heroes' Monument🏺 historical

The memorial preserves the names and memory of the local soldiers and victims who perished in both World Wars. It serves as a central point of reflection and remembrance in the town.
